Alstom supplies equipment for biggest Colombian hydro plant
13 November, 2012
Alstom has been awarded a contract worth around €170M, by Empresas Públicas de Medellín (EPM) to supply turbine and generator units for the Ituango hydro power plant on the Cauca river in Colombia. It will be the country’s biggest hydro plant generating 2400MW.

Alstom successfully delivers the first unit of the Xiangjiaba plant
07 November, 2012
Alstom has successfully delivered the first generating unit at the Xiangjiaba hydropower plant in China. The 800MW Francis turbine and 889MVA generator unit passed a reliability trial run of 72 hours and recently began commercial operation.

Alstom to equip Baixo Iguaçu plant, Brazil
01 October, 2012
Alstom has signed a contract with Neoenergia for the supply of three Kaplan hydro turbines, generators, control command and protection systems as well as electromechanical and erection equipment for the Baixo Iguaçu hydropower plant in Brazil. The total contract value is €160M, including hydromechanical and lifting equipment, with Alstom’s share around €110M.

World Bank debars Alstom Hydro France for three years
24 February, 2012
Alstom Hydro France and Alstom Network Schweiz AG - in addition to their affiliates - have been barred from working on World Bank funded projects for three years following their acknowledgment of misconduct in relation to a hydropower project in Zambia, the World Bank has announced.

Alstom to modernise Canada's largest hydro scheme
06 January, 2012
Canadian utility Hydro-Quebec has awarded Alstom a EUR50M contract to modernize the 5616MW Robert-Bourassa generating facility on the La Grande River in northern Quebec, the largest hydroelectric scheme in the country.
